In this classic tale, Ebenezer Scrooge embodies the essence of a bitter and miserly Victorian businessman who holds little regard for Christmas or the joy it brings to others. Living in stark contrast to his impoverished clerk Bob Cratchit and jovial nephew Fred, Scrooge remains impervious to the holiday's spirit of generosity and warmth. However, as the night unfolds, Scrooge finds himself visited by three spectral entities - the Ghosts of Christmas Past, Present, and Yet to Come. These otherworldly beings guide Scrooge through a series of profound and transformative experiences that offer him a glimpse into the consequences of his actions, the reality he has created for himself and others, and the potential pathways available should he choose to change. Through these haunting encounters, the story explores themes of redemption, self-reflection, and the power of empathy.
